The Lindsay Theater and Cultural Center is a Pennsylvania 501(c)(3) nonprofit organization in Sewickley, PA, with a mission to strengthen cultural, educational and entertainment experiences northwest of Pittsburgh. This means all revenues and donations are invested back into the Theater and its programming. The organization has no owners or stockholders and exists to benefit the public.
